Accessing public records in Ardmore, OK

Ardmore is incorporated with a local city government which will contain some public records. But most public records are held by Carter County court and the county clerk's office. Local law enforcement agencies will also hold records related to criminal offenses. These agencies are Carter County Sheriff's Office and Ardmore Police Department.

The below state agencies will also hold records for Ardmore residents.

Oklahoma State Department of Health: Provides access to vital records such as birth certificates, death certificates, marriage certificates, and divorce records.

Oklahoma Department of Corrections: Provides access to records related to incarcerated individuals, including inmate records and prison information.

Oklahoma State Department of Education: Offers access to educational records, including information on schools, districts, and educational statistics.

Oklahoma Department of Public Safety: Manages records related to driver's licenses, vehicle registrations, and driving records.

Oklahoma Secretary of State: Maintains records related to business entities, including corporate filings, trademarks, and trade names.

On average, overall crime occurs 86% more than the national average and is solved 37% of the time. In Ardmore, Burglary is committed at a per capita rate (944.1 / 100k residents) which is 250% higher than the national average. Over the last 5 years, Burglary occurred 234.4 times per year. And Robbery occurs at a lower rate of -23% less than the national average.

The household income level of $25,000 To $35,000 is 92% more common than the national average, making up 15% of the population. And the household income level of $150,000 Over is -64% less common than the national average, making up 6.2% of the population in Ardmore.

The education level of Highschool is 37% more common than the national average, making up 33.6% of the population. And the education level of Bachelors is -41% less common than the national average, making up 12% of the population in Ardmore.

In Ardmore, the Health Uninsured percent is 106% higher than the national average, making up 17% of the population. And Limited English percent is -73% lower than the national average, making up 1.4% of the population.
